The campus recently became the first in the nation to boast certified organic salad bars, meaning the cafeteria fare designated for the typical college salad bar, the dressings, meats and veggies must now be organically grown and prepared in certified kitchens. Some could argue that this move wastes academic funds as we all are aware that organic fare is pricy often two to three times more conventional, but thanks to negotiating and alumni who just happen to produce organic salad dressing. UC Berkeley projects that the certified organic salad bar will cost only 10-15% percent more, a drop in for the bucket their wealthy undergrads.
